First, I've read the first two books in the series and have been looking forward to this one for a while. I was disappointed to start reading it and saw that it was enemies to lovers. Not my favorite. But this was more than that thank goodness. But let me get the complaints out of the way first. There were abrupt scene changes. Several times I was wait, what? Oh, okay. And the messages back and forth, sometimes it was hard to tell who was saying what. They weren't labeled in any way. It would have been nice to have more distinction.

This book was a page turner. I hope no one gives it away. I pieced together some, but not all, and it still had a wow factor. I laughed so many times, it just took a little while to get to the fun stuff. I ended up enjoying it more than I expected when I initially started it. Not a let down in the least.
